Operational cost reductions enabled by stirling cryocooler efficiency

A key advantage of the stirling cryocooler lies in its significantly improved energy efficiency compared to standard compressor-based refrigeration systems. These cryocoolers operate on a unique Stirling thermodynamic cycle combined with a free-piston structure, which minimizes energy loss and delivers cooling capacity with optimized power consumption. This design enables the cryocooler to consume up to 30% less energy, resulting in substantial operational cost savings over its lifecycle. Organizations relying on precision ultra-low temperature environments, such as laboratories or aerospace facilities, benefit from this efficiency by reducing their utility expenses without compromising performance. A seasoned stirling cryocooler manufacturer focuses on producing reliable units with integrated cooling fans that stabilize temperature quickly and maintain ±0.1℃ accuracy, thereby reducing fluctuations that often lead to inefficiencies and increased power use. Longevity and maintenance benefits of free-piston stirling cryocoolers

Longevity and low maintenance requirements stand out as significant considerations when adopting cooling technology. Free-piston stirling cryocoolers, produced by leading stirling cryocooler manufacturers, offer service lives exceeding 70,000 hours of continuous operation. Their design minimizes wear and tear by reducing mechanical contact points, unlike traditional compressor mechanisms prone to faster degradation. This durability translates into fewer maintenance interventions, lowering downtime risks and associated repair costs. Facilities dependent on the consistent cooling of sensitive instruments, such as MRI superconducting magnets or biological sample storage units, reap the benefits of extended service intervals and higher system availability.
